'The Global System Operators' Association (GSMA) estimates that telecom operators will invest $45.2 billion in the mobile network in sub-Saharan Africa by 2025. Mobile penetration over the period is expected to increase from 46% currently to 50% and the number of subscribers will go from 495 million to 615 million as a result of growing demand for telecom services. The African Development Bank Group’s Board of Directors has approved a loan of $86.72 million to co-finance the second phase of the Lesotho Highlands Water Project. The multi-phase project will provide water to the Gauteng region of South Africa and generate hydroelectricity for Lesotho. The African Development Bank has welcomed $150 million investment in its Desert to Power G5 Financing Facility from the Green Climate Fund (GCF). The GCF approved the amount at its 30th Board meeting this week. Desert-to-Power is a flagship renewable energy and economic development initiative led by the African Development Bank.
